Output ec23feb17c9f80a0f2832e814242e2f2afa363e43ce355091fafe5fb3ca5927c:1

value
75020970
script pubkey
OP_0 OP_PUSHBYTES_20 86b64e2d851851c1d4436c2a18f2527d10820120
address
ltc1qs6myutv9rpgur4zrds4p3ujj05ggyqfqde39ls
transaction
ec23feb17c9f80a0f2832e814242e2f2afa363e43ce355091fafe5fb3ca5927c
spent
true